Boating is a great way to relax and enjoy the outdoors, but it can also be a competitive sport. Whether you’re racing against other boats or just trying to get the best spot on the lake, it’s important to have a few strategies up your sleeve to outmaneuver your competitors. Here are some tips to help you stay ahead of the pack.
1. Know the Course: Before you even get on the water, it’s important to familiarize yourself with the course. Take the time to study the layout of the lake or river, noting any obstacles or hazards that could affect your performance. Knowing the course will help you plan your route and anticipate any potential problems.
2. Choose the Right Boat: Different boats are designed for different purposes, so it’s important to choose the right one for the job. If you’re racing, you’ll want a boat that’s fast and maneuverable. If you’re just out for a leisurely cruise, you’ll want something more comfortable and stable.
3. Practice Makes Perfect: Even if you’re an experienced boater, it’s important to practice before you hit the water. Spend some time getting comfortable with your boat and its controls, and practice maneuvering in different conditions. This will help you stay in control and react quickly when you’re out on the water.
4. Stay Alert: When you’re out on the water, it’s important to stay alert and aware of your surroundings. Keep an eye out for other boats, obstacles, and changing weather conditions. This will help you anticipate any potential problems and react quickly.
5. Use the Wind: Wind can be your friend or your enemy, depending on how you use it. If you’re racing, use the wind to your advantage by sailing upwind and downwind. This will help you gain speed and stay ahead of the competition.
6. Be Flexible: Boating conditions can change quickly, so it’s important to be flexible and adapt to the situation. If the wind shifts or the waves get choppy, adjust your course accordingly. This will help you stay in control and stay ahead of the competition.
